The Hallmark of a Great Leader is a well-developed handbook for business executives to follow in pursuing their career aspirations. It presents best practices within nine areas of focus: vision, leadership style, social intelligence, strategic thinking, political conscience, influence, information dissemination, education, and emotional wellness. The material comes from the perspective of a chief information officer (CIO), but it is clearly stated that the principles apply to all business executives.

Introduction
Welcome to The Hallmark of a Great Leader . Througho ut this book, I will reference the term chief information officer (CIO) because my career journey in business and technology radically sharpened my understanding of leadership and organizational effectiveness. I grew through the digital executive ranks, and it was through the CIO lens that I experienced my leadership journey to share with my audience and future leaders.
The Hallmark of a Great Leader will inspire and entertain you but, more importantly, keep you honest throughout your career as an executive. When I thought about writing this book, I realized that many of my CIO colleagues and C-suite executives struggled to navigate the complex web of corporate and executive leadership. I found this to be true for technology executives, but the leadership principles in this book apply to leaders in all sectors.
